Boosting Pumpkin Yields with AI
The age-old quest for optimizing pumpkin yields is getting a innovative boost thanks to the power of machine intelligence. Data-driven systems are being employed to analyze vast pools of data on elements such as soil composition, weather conditions, and planting methods. These insights can help farmers estimate yields more accurately, fine-tune their farming practices in real time, and ultimately cultivate healthier, more abundant pumpkin harvests.
- Example one innovative AI system that can analyze satellite imagery to identify areas of stress in pumpkin plants. By flagging these issues early on, farmers can take action promptly and reduce potential damage.
- Another promising application involves using AI to predict pumpkin prices based on market trends. This can help farmers formulate more informed decisions about when to gather their pumpkins for maximum profit.
As a result, AI is poised to revolutionize the pumpkin industry, boosting yields while promoting sustainable farming practices. From plantlet to gourd, AI is helping farmers in every step of the journey, unlocking the true potential of this beloved autumnal fruit.
